address scope

address scope

An address scope is a scope of IPv4 or IPv6 addresses that belongs to a given project and may be shared between projects.

Network v2

address scope create

Create a new Address Scope

openstack address scope create
    [--extra-property type=<property_type>,name=<property_name>,value=<property_value>]
    [--ip-version {4,6}]
    [--project <project>]
    [--project-domain <project-domain>]
    [--share | --no-share]
    <name>
--extra-property type=<property_type>,name=<property_name>,value=<property_value>

Additional parameters can be passed using this property. Default type of the extra property is string (‘str’), but other types can be used as well. Available types are: ‘dict’, ‘list’, ‘str’, ‘bool’, ‘int’. In case of ‘list’ type, ‘value’ can be semicolon-separated list of values. For ‘dict’ value is semicolon-separated list of the key:value pairs.

--ip-version <IP_VERSION>

IP version (default is 4)

--project <project>

Owner’s project (name or ID)

--project-domain <project-domain>

Domain the project belongs to (name or ID). This can be used in case collisions between project names exist.

--share

Share the address scope between projects

--no-share

Do not share the address scope between projects (default)

name

New address scope name

address scope delete

Delete address scope(s)

openstack address scope delete <address-scope> [<address-scope> ...]
address-scope

Address scope(s) to delete (name or ID)

address scope list

List address scopes

openstack address scope list
    [--format-config-file FORMAT_CONFIG]
    [--sort-column SORT_COLUMN]
    [--sort-ascending | --sort-descending]
    [--name <name>]
    [--ip-version <ip-version>]
    [--project <project>]
    [--project-domain <project-domain>]
    [--share | --no-share]
--format-config-file <FORMAT_CONFIG>

Config file for the dict-to-csv formatter

--sort-column SORT_COLUMN

specify the column(s) to sort the data (columns specified first have a priority, non-existing columns are ignored), can be repeated

--sort-ascending

sort the column(s) in ascending order

--sort-descending

sort the column(s) in descending order

--name <name>

List only address scopes of given name in output

--ip-version <ip-version>

List address scopes of given IP version networks (4 or 6)

--project <project>

List address scopes according to their project (name or ID)

--project-domain <project-domain>

Domain the project belongs to (name or ID). This can be used in case collisions between project names exist.

--share

List address scopes shared between projects

--no-share

List address scopes not shared between projects

address scope set

Set address scope properties

openstack address scope set
    [--extra-property type=<property_type>,name=<property_name>,value=<property_value>]
    [--name <name>]
    [--share | --no-share]
    <address-scope>
--extra-property type=<property_type>,name=<property_name>,value=<property_value>

Additional parameters can be passed using this property. Default type of the extra property is string (‘str’), but other types can be used as well. Available types are: ‘dict’, ‘list’, ‘str’, ‘bool’, ‘int’. In case of ‘list’ type, ‘value’ can be semicolon-separated list of values. For ‘dict’ value is semicolon-separated list of the key:value pairs.

--name <name>

Set address scope name

--share

Share the address scope between projects

--no-share

Do not share the address scope between projects

address-scope

Address scope to modify (name or ID)

address scope show

Display address scope details

openstack address scope show <address-scope>
address-scope

Address scope to display (name or ID)

Creative Commons Attribution 3.0 License

Except where otherwise noted, this document is licensed under Creative Commons Attribution 3.0 License. See all OpenStack Legal Documents.